**Postmortem timeline — 14:22**

This is where things got interesting. The Shopglen catalog cache was supposed to invalidate on price updates, but the fanout job silently skipped any SKU batch over 10k items. So customers saw stale prices for almost forty minutes while the dashboard looked perfectly green. Priya spotted it by diffing cache keys against the source table. We rolled forward with a hotfix rather than reverting. The trace token from the failing job follows.

pipeline stamp: htk31_f769b577b3028a4e9958e5bb8d1259a

When the fan-out tier can't keep pace with inbound events, the dispatcher switches to bounded-queue mode: low-priority notifications (digests, marketing) are shed first, while transactional messages are retried with exponential backoff for up to 30 minutes. You'll see the `fanout_backpressure_active` gauge flip to 1 and delivery latency climb on the dashboard. This is expected behaviour during spikes and usually self-resolves. If it persists beyond an hour, or transactional messages start dropping, contact the messaging platform owners.

billing contact of tahaf-tadug = quenath@tolvaqcorp.corp

Onboarding note for load testing the Cartwright checkout flow: use the Stampede harness against the staging cluster only, ramping to 500 virtual shoppers over ten minutes. Baseline latency targets live in `perf/targets.json`. Results post automatically to the sync dashboard. Before your first run, register your harness instance with the gateway, which requires signing the enrollment manifest with the key shown below.

rollout seal: bky4_yke3